Just to add to this statement. A vet visit during quarantine is definitely something I would advise. Running tests is great too but the reason for quarantine is because birds often hid illnesses and having tests done will not rule out all illnesses. So just because a vet assumes a bird is healthy doesn't always mean they are sadly. This is why quarantine is important.

Why a bird is quarantined when you first bring it home is partly because a new environment can be stressful and if bird is carrying some sort of infectious illnesses hopefully it will will come out during quarantine because of that stress. That said it may not. But quarantine is definitely a worthwhile endeavor because while not 100percent reliable, it is better than nothing and can potentially save your other birds from infectious illness.
